INSPECTION HISTORY

JUN 16
2011
PASS 6 violations
Minor Sanitation
FOOD AND NON-FOOD CONTACT SURFACES PROPERLY DESIGNED, CONSTRUCTED AND MAINTAINED

All food and non-food contact equipment and utensils shall be smooth, easily cleanable, and durable, and shall be in good repair.INSTRUCTED MANAGER TO REPLACE BROKEN GASKET AT 2 DOOR COOLER IN BASEMENT,CUTTING BOARDS WITH DEEP CUTS MUST BE REPLACED.

Minor Sanitation
FOOD AND NON-FOOD CONTACT EQUIPMENT UTENSILS CLEAN, FREE OF ABRASIVE DETERGENTS

All food and non-food contact surfaces of equipment and all food storage utensils shall be thoroughly cleaned and sanitized daily.THE FOLLOWING REQUIRES DETAIL CLEANING MANUAL CAN OPENER,HOUSING ATTACHED,BAR GUN,HOUSING ATTACHED BAR,SHELVING,FAN COVERS INSIDE THE WALK-IN-COOLER,TOPS/BOTTTOMS OF PREP TABLES INCLUDING LEGS OF EQUIPMENTS.

Minor Sanitation
WALLS, CEILINGS, ATTACHED EQUIPMENT CONSTRUCTED PER CODE: GOOD REPAIR, SURFACES CLEAN AND DUST-LESS CLEANING METHODS

The walls and ceilings shall be in good repair and easily cleaned.INSTRUCTED MANAGER TO CLEAN CEILING,ATTACHED EQUIPMENTS AT MAIN KITCHEN AND MAINTAIN,SEAL OPENINGS AT CEILING OVER DRY STORAGE SHELVINGS LOCATED AT NORTH BASEMENT.

Minor Facility Condition
LIGHTING: REQUIRED MINIMUM FOOT-CANDLES OF LIGHT PROVIDED, FIXTURES SHIELDED

Shielding to protect against broken glass falling into food shall be provided for all artificial lighting sources in preparation, service, and display facilities.INSTRUCTED MANAGER TO PROVIDE MISSING LIGHT SHIELDS IN BASEMENT FOOD PREP AREA.

Minor Plumbing & Waste
VENTILATION: ROOMS AND EQUIPMENT VENTED AS REQUIRED: PLUMBING: INSTALLED AND MAINTAINED

Ventilation: All plumbing fixtures, such as toilets, sinks, washbasins, etc., must be adequately trapped, vented, and re-vented and properly connected to the sewer in accordance with the plumbing chapter of the Municipal Code of Chicago and the Rules and Regulations of the Board of Health.INSTRUCTED MANAGER TO REPAIR WATER LEAK AT BASE OF FAUCET 3 COMP SINK BAR.

Minor Sanitation
FOOD (ICE) DISPENSING UTENSILS, WASH CLOTHS PROPERLY STORED

Between uses and during storage ice dispensing utensils and ice receptacles shall be stored in a way that protects them from contamination.INSTRUCTED MANAGER TO MAINTAIN WIPING CLOTHS IN A SANITIZING SOLUTION AT ALL TIMES.
